Designing Your Under Stair Shelf Storage

Before you start installing shelves, it's crucial to plan your under stair storage design carefully. Consider the shape and size of the space, as well as your storage needs.

Measure the height, width, and depth of the area. This will help you determine the size and number of shelves you can accommodate. Also, consider the weight capacity of the shelves to ensure they can support the items you plan to store.

Custom vs. Prefabricated Shelves

Your first decision is whether to use custom-built or prefabricated shelves. Custom shelves offer the advantage of being tailored to your specific space and storage needs. They can be designed to fit around pipes, support beams, or other obstacles, making the most of every inch of space.

On the other hand, prefabricated shelves are often more affordable and quicker to install. They come in standard sizes, so you'll need to ensure they fit your space. If they don't, you might need to make adjustments or use them as a starting point and build out from there.

Shelf Materials and Finishes

Shelves can be made from various materials, including wood, metal, and plastic. The material you choose depends on your budget, the look you want to achieve, and the items you'll be storing.

Wood is a classic choice that offers a warm, inviting look. It's also strong and durable. Metal shelves are modern and industrial-looking, while plastic is lightweight, affordable, and easy to clean. Consider the finish as well - painted, stained, or natural - to ensure it complements your home's decor.

Organizing Your Under Stair Shelf Storage

Once your shelves are installed, it's time to start organizing. The key to effective under stair storage is to make the most of the vertical space and keep items easily accessible.

Start by grouping items by category - for example, books, toys, or kitchenware. This will make it easier to find what you need and keep the space organized.

Maximizing Vertical Space

Use tall, narrow storage boxes or bins to make the most of the vertical space. These can be stacked on top of each other, keeping items off the floor and making the area feel less cluttered.

Consider using shelves with adjustable heights. This allows you to create larger spaces for bulkier items or taller objects, and smaller spaces for lighter, more compact items.

Accessibility and Safety

To ensure easy access to your stored items, consider installing pull-out shelves or drawers. These allow you to slide items out of the way to access what's behind them, making it easier to find what you need.

Safety is also crucial, especially if you have young children or pets. Install safety latches on drawers and cabinets to prevent them from being opened accidentally. Also, ensure that heavy or fragile items are stored at a safe height to prevent accidents.
